About the Role
As the Executive Sous Chef, you will be a key leader in the culinary team, working directly under the Executive Chef and assuming full operational responsibility in their absence. This role involves overseeing daily kitchen operations, including meal planning, procurement of food supplies, kitchen equipment, and meal production. You will supervise and coordinate the work of kitchen staff, ensuring that food preparation is executed to Invited’s high-quality standards while maintaining cost efficiency. This position is designed as a developmental role, providing the Executive Sous Chef with the knowledge and problem-solving abilities needed for advancement to an Executive Chef position.
Responsibilities
- Oversee the development and execution of menus and meal planning/production, adapting to forecasted Member counts to ensure optimal service and product quality.
- Ensure cleanliness and sanitation of the kitchen including equipment, work areas, counters, tools, and waste management, maintaining high standards of hygiene and safety.
- Procure food supplies and kitchen equipment, including inventory organization and participation in periodic inventory counts.
- Determine budgetary requirements for food supplies, kitchen equipment, and materials, ensuring cost-effectiveness and adherence to financial guidelines.
- Analyze food and labor production reports, utilizing menu engineering and other data to control expenses and optimize operational efficiency.
- Lead the recruitment, selection, and hiring processes for kitchen staff, incorporating the Executive Chef’s insights and recommendations to build a high-performing team.
- Coordinate scheduling and adjust work hours and responsibilities to meet operational needs, addressing employee concerns and resolving issues promptly.
- Evaluate and implement policies to uphold safe workplace practices, addressing and resolving any safety issues to ensure a secure environment for all employees.
- Act as a key representative of the club in member interactions, including conducting daily table visits, gathering feedback, and promoting the club’s reputation within the community and industry.
- Provide professional and responsive service to members and guests, addressing requests and concerns with a focus on exceeding expectations and ensuring satisfaction.
- Lead by example and participate actively as a team member.
- Regularly direct and oversee the work of at least two or more full-time employees, ensuring effective teamwork and operational cohesion.
